Find a Saved Wi-Fi Password in Windows 11
Source-checked About 10 minutes
Answer
Open the connected network's properties and select Show beside Wi-Fi network password. You can also view saved networks you are authorized to access.
Open the current Wi-Fi properties
On a Windows PC authorized to use the network, open Settings > Network & internet and select Properties for the current Wi-Fi connection.

Reveal the password
Next to Wi-Fi network password, select Show and complete any Windows security prompt.
Check another saved network
Open Wi-Fi > Manage known networks, choose the authorized network and select Show beside its password when available.
Protect the credential
Do not reveal, copy or share a network password without the network owner's permission. Prefer the displayed QR code for trusted guests when available.

If it does not work
- If Show is unavailable, install current Windows updates and confirm the PC has a saved profile for that network. Managed-device policy can restrict password display.
- If another device cannot connect, scan the displayed QR code or enter the password exactly; do not change the router password merely because one device retained an old profile.
